Annotation: The I Can Do Math series uses food, friends, toys, and crayons to help beginning readers learn basic math skills. Large photos and bright colors make each easy, first-step number problem more interesting, as well as easier to understand. A short math quiz ends each volume to reinforce the skills presented and to provide a quick review. What's more un than counting to ten? Adding numbers that equal ten! Different numbers of apples, oranges, cookies, and toys illustrate simple addition problems that all add up to ten.
